Port AD1 reduced drive—Select reduced drive for Port AD1 outputs
This register configures the drive strength of Port AD1 output pins 15 through 8 as either full or reduced independent
of the function used on the pins. If a pin is used as input this bit has no effect.
1 Reduced drive selected (approx. 1/5 of the full drive strength).
0 Full drive strength enabled.
